How to use VuongQuoc/Debertalarg_model_multichoice_Version2 with Transformers:
# Load model directly from transformers import AutoTokenizer, AutoModelForMultipleChoice tokenizer = AutoTokenizer.from_pretrained("VuongQuoc/Debertalarg_model_multichoice_Version2") model = AutoModelForMultipleChoice.from_pretrained("VuongQuoc/Debertalarg_model_multichoice_Version2", device_map="auto") - Notebooks
